It was such a blessing that I got that 15 minutes before it started pouring heavily. As the entrance is small and tends to flood a little, a trip here in a rainy day makes for a little adventure for your white and/or fancy branded shoes.

Inside, you’ll find a large, cavernous space that is home to two distinct sections. The section that I interacted with was the cafe itself. I was seated in the middle and it was a little bit like a stage. That said, I never once felt I had too many eyes or ears on me. The cafe is generally lively - not exactly the cafe for chilling with a book, but it’s brilliant for some laughter with your mates.

Food and drinks offered were enticing. But we settled for what seems safe. Pesto spaghetti was brilliant, but personally, it could do with a little more garlic notes. The Thai Basil pasta wasn’t quite what was expected in terms of flavour, but it wasn’t poor. The portioning of the Angus beef bagel was generous. Flavours were on point, but a tad bit surfeiting. Truffle fries were done well - great for sharing.

Coffees were brilliant. Latte, flat white, matcha latte - all great in their own ways. The latte and flat white were fragrant and not unpleasantly bitter. I know I enjoy it when I don’t call for sugar syrup to be added. The matcha latte tasted legit, but was a little too powdery, else, it was good.

The overall bill was the most pleasing - from the pov of someone earning Singapore dollars, that is.

About Johor Bahru
City in Malaysia

Johor Bahru, colloquially referred to as JB, is the capital city of the state of Johor, Malaysia and the core city of Johor Bahru District, the second largest district in Malaysia by population. source
